Latest Patents

Hope L. Bauer holds a patent for a method of adding constrained cluster points to interconnection nets, aimed at enhancing the wiring of multiple integrated circuits. This innovative method allows for the efficient wiring of circuits within a chip or between chips in various packages by incorporating cluster points into a net that consists of numerous nodes. Through her patented approach, Bauer ensures that the interconnected nodes meet essential system requirements dictated by a set of wiring rules, which include physical, electrical, and noise constraints.

The process detailed in her patent involves matching interconnection net attributes to logical definitions of wiring rules, defining both rule nodes and rule connections. Rule nodes specify constraints for pins, vias, and structures, while rule connections establish wiring constraints to determine net topology. Her method emphasizes net ordering and checking, allowing for pin-to-pin connections based on the wiring rule prior to the actual wiring of chips or packages. This comprehensive verification process guarantees the accuracy of net attributes once the design is complete.
